Title: Fazel Khan: Innovator in Surgical Technology
Introduction
Fazel Khan is a notable inventor based in East Setauket, NY (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of surgical technology, holding a total of 3 patents. His innovative work focuses on enhancing surgical procedures and improving patient outcomes.
Latest Patents
One of Fazel Khan's latest patents is a "System and method to conduct bone surgery." This surgical system includes a camera that captures images and/or video, a projector that projects light, and a controller that tracks the movement of bone in real-time during surgery. The controller also manages the projector to display a cutting line on the bone, indicating the cutting plane for precise bone cutting during surgery. Another significant patent is the "System and method for identifying fractures in digitized x-rays." This method involves obtaining a digitized x-ray image, enhancing its resolution, and evaluating pixel intensity to identify potential fractures. The process includes flagging pixels indicative of fractures and visually indicating their locations on the modified x-ray image.
